111 Ants
Players take a hand of unsorted numbered cards and on each turn draw either a face-down or face-up card, place it into the correct position within their tableau, then place one additional card immediately to the left or right of that placement. The objective is to be the first to arrange all cards in strict ascending or descending order, managing limited information from face-down draws and competing for useful face-up cards. Play emphasizes careful placement, tactical swaps, and memory as players try to assemble complete runs while mitigating the scarcity of ideally positioned cards.
